Post by Kazuya_UK on Aug 3, 2003 8:11:47 GMT -5
It is possible to do it - if you have a Euro MVS board, you don't even need a uni-bios to get English language AND the Japanese music tracks. All you do is go to the soft dipswitches and change the country region to "USA" (it is set to "others" by default). Do that and you are sorted  . If you have an MVS with a US bios, you'll need to get a uni-bios so that you can switch to Euro mode. Anybody with an MVS should get a uni-bios anyway, as it is more than worth it imho  Sengoku 3 never really had totally red blood from what I remember... I could be wrong though. As for games like Samurai Shodown and Last Blade, if you have an MVS there is an option you can change on the dipswitches that enables red blood/fatalities... it's usually just labelled as "blood: on/off" or "Cruel fight: on/off". If you have the home cart of SS2 there is a little trick you can use to enable blood, and I think there are sometimes codes in certain games (NOT ALL) that enable blood or bouncy breats in KoF.
